Output f9ced937998cf88a396bd6db3a38d34729382179a4c1dfae9a87abbfb0de88fc:22

value
10136936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73b13f905c6c82d5d8f025f94c9e1b2a7104481a OP_EQUAL
address
3CEjy2oDw8duiqyUipDcwRxEyHPfpjRnCe
transaction
f9ced937998cf88a396bd6db3a38d34729382179a4c1dfae9a87abbfb0de88fc
confirmations
471655
spent
true